Max Verstappen signs new £37m-A-YEAR Red Bull deal with F1 champ now in same pay bracket as rival Lewis Hamilton

MAX VERSTAPPEN has penned a new £37million-a-year contract with Red Bull.

And now the reigning champion is in the same pay bracket as bitter title rival Lewis Hamilton.

The Dutch driver, 24, will now be tied to the team until after his 30th birthday after committing his future to them.

He visited Red Bull’s factory in Milton Keynes yesterday to wrap-up his bumper extension after initially agreeing terms while in Barcelona last week for pre-season testing.

Verstappen’s pay rise has now fired him right up alongside £40m-a-year Hamilton as Formula One’s top earner.

However, given the length of his contract, it could be argued that it is the most remunerative package in F1 history.

Red Bull have yet to officially confirm that Verstappen has agreed to the extension but are believed to be set to confirm the news later this week.

However, Sun Sport understands that it is all done and despite reports elsewhere, it is worth £37m per year.

Mercedes boss Toto Wolff had been trying to lure Verstappen over to them but that move broke down at Silverstone in 2020.

The driver was involved in a 180mph collision with Hamilton and needed hospital treatment afterwards.

But he was upset with how enthusiastically Mercedes celebrated victory while medics attended to him.

Verstappen begins his title defence in Bahrain in 18 days.

That will be his eighth season in F1 and debuting aged 17 in the 2015 Australian Grand Prix for Toro Rosso.
